INTRODUCTION
PURPOSE AND OBJECTIVES
Cowlitz County, hereafter called "County,” is seeking proposals for the provision of Landfill Gas
Management Services at the Cowlitz County Headquarters Landfill and the closed Cowlitz County
Tennant Way Landfill. Service provided will include, but not be limited to, landfill gas compliance
testing and reporting, gas collection and control system (GCCS) adjustments and troubleshooting.
Cowlitz County requires the Contractor to be committed to maintaining the highest professional
standards. To this end, adherence to the terms and conditions of the Request for Proposal and
associated documents are required.
The County intends to award one contract to provide the services described in this RFP.
SCOPE OF WORK
The task order process will consist of the County contacting and requesting services for a specific
project. The consultant will then develop a detailed scope and budget for each request. When
the scope and budget is agreed upon a task order will be issued that includes the budget and
date of delivery. Any changes to the cost, scope of work or schedule must be agreed upon by
the Consultant and the County in writing.
The consultant will provide all management, materials, equipment, labor and other items
necessary to provide various testing services for permit compliance of the County owned landfills
as needed. The quantity and duration of testing services will depend on the County’s
requirements and needs for these services.
The services to be provided include but are not limited to, any or all of the following:
1) Project Management and Coordination
a) Provide a designated Project Manager for the duration of any task order.
b) Scheduling and coordination of Services to meet reporting frequencies and
deadlines.
c) Provide test reports for inclusion into the project files.
d) Provide final reports to the County.
2) Landfill Gas Monitoring and Reporting
a) The Consultant shall prepare and submit required reporting for regulatory
agencies including but not limited to EHU, SWCAA, DOE and EPA.
b) The Consultant shall support electronic report submittals to various platforms
including but not limited to EGGRT, EPA, CDX, SAW.
3) Gas Collection and Control System Adjustments and Troubleshooting
a) The Consultant shall evaluate monitoring information and provide input and
oversight for gas management.
b) The Consultant shall manage and troubleshoot SCADA system.

PRICING
During the contract period, the stated price of the contract’s proposal may be adjusted based on
the Consumer Price Index (“CPI), as follows:
At the beginning of each contract extension, the prices shall be increased or decreased by the same
percentage as the percent change in the CPI for the twelve (12) months ending the preceding
January. “CPI” means Consumer Price Index, All Cities, Urban Workers and Clerical Workers, (CPI-
W), 1982=100, as published by the United States Department of Labor, Bureau of Labor Statistics
Cowlitz County Request for Proposals # 2025-0060-01
Page 4 of 24
(“CPI”). If the Bureau of Labor Statistics ceases to publish that index in its present form, the parties
shall substitute another index to reflect inflation in comparable terms.
